Linux 中如何使用指令重新啟動服務?
在Linux作業系統中,經常需要重新啟動服務來確保服務正常運作或套用配置的更新。重新啟動一個服務可以透過使用特定的命令來實現,本文將介紹如何在Linux中使用命令重新啟動服務的方法,並提供具體的程式碼範例。
在重新啟動一個服務之前,我們通常需要先查看該服務的目前狀態,以確保服務的運行情況。我們可以使用以下命令來查看服務的狀態:
systemctl status 服务名
例如,如果我們要查看Nginx 服務的狀態,可以使用以下命令:
systemctl status nginx
一旦我們確認了服務的狀態,我們可以開始重新啟動該服務。重新啟動服務的指令格式如下:
sudo systemctl restart 服务名
例如,如果我們要重新啟動Apache 服務,可以使用下列指令:
sudo systemctl restart apache2
重新啟動服務之後,我們可以使用以下命令來檢查服務的運行狀態,確保服務已經重新啟動成功:
systemctl status 服务名
例如,我們可以再次執行以下命令來查看Apache 服務的狀態:
systemctl status apache2
在重新啟動服務時,需要注意一些事項,例如確保重新啟動服務不會造成服務中斷,避免在關鍵時刻進行操作等。另外,有些服務可能會在重新啟動後自動載入新的配置,但有些服務可能需要手動重新載入設定檔才能生效。所以,在重新啟動服務之前,最好先了解該服務的運作特性和配置需求。
總結:
在Linux中重新啟動服務是保證服務正常運作的重要操作之一。透過上述介紹的方法和程式碼範例,我們可以輕鬆地在Linux系統中重新啟動服務。記住在重新啟動服務之前,最好先查看服務的狀態,以確保服務正常運行,並在重新啟動服務後檢查服務的狀態,確保重新啟動成功。希望本文能幫助您更了解並使用Linux系統中重新啟動服務的方法。
以上是Linux 中如何使用指令重新啟動服務?的詳細內容。更多資訊請關注PHP中文網其他相關文章!